Lake Bluff Public Library Welcomes New Director

Natalie Starosta
The Board of Trustees of the Lake Bluff Public Library has announced the appointment of Natalie Starosta as the Library’s new Director. Ms. Starosta will begin her role on Monday, March 10, 2025, following a nationwide search for the position.

Ms. Starosta brings over a decade of experience in transforming library services to better serve diverse communities, with a strong background in innovation, community engagement, and staff development. She most recently served as the Director of the North Riverside Public Library District, where she oversaw more than $1 million in renovations, created advanced makerspaces, launched a pop-up library in a local mall, and expanded virtual programming to better serve the community. Prior to that, she served as a Library Director in Michigan before moving to Illinois.

The Library Board was particularly impressed by Ms. Starosta’s ability to navigate challenges and implement successful solutions. “Natalie has encountered some of the challenges we’re facing at Lake Bluff,” said Trustee Alexandra Friedeman. “We liked the fact that she’s had success resolving them and leading her library to a better place.” Trustee Janie Jerch highlighted Ms. Starosta’s relationship-building skills, noting, “She empowers her staff to work with local agencies and organizations. Everyone benefits when we work together.” Trustee Jenny Graziano praised Ms. Starosta’s leadership in staff development, stating, “Natalie finds small ways to encourage staff to try new things and grow professionally. This makes them more confident and creative, leading to better services for Lake Bluff residents.”

Ms. Starosta is also an active leader in the broader library community, having served on the American Library Association’s (ALA) Council, acted as a policy monitor, and contributed as a grant reviewer for various library associations. With a robust background in change management, budgeting, and strategic planning, she continues to lead libraries toward becoming vital, inclusive community hubs. Her leadership style prioritizes creative problem-solving, staff empowerment, and fostering strong community partnerships with businesses, schools, and local organizations.

The Lake Bluff Public Library looks forward to the experience and vision Ms. Starosta will bring to the Library and the community.
